For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 87 students in Rum River Special Education Coop School District. This district's average pre testing ranking is 1/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public pre schools in Minnesota.
Public Preschool in Rum River Special Education Coop School District have an average math proficiency score of 15% (versus the Minnesota public pre school average of 46%), and reading proficiency score of 30% (versus the 47%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 21% of the student body (majority American Indian and Black), which is less than the Minnesota public preschool average of 42% (majority Hispanic and Black).

The revenue/student of $110,724 is higher than the state median of $17,854. The school district revenue/student has grown by 8%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$101,529 is higher than the state median of $18,580. The school district spending/student has grown by 8% over four school years.
